Consuelo Sedano De Sousa

July 4, 1936 — May 3, 2025

Consuelo, the name says it all. In Spanish, it means to counsel, and that she did. My mother a beacon of counsel and hope to many. Through her voice as a singer and actress, her lyrics counseled and soothed many a heart. From her early years singing on radio as a child to her career later in life as an accomplished voice over actress. She was sought after acknowledged and awarded for her many contributions in the Los Angeles and Pasadena community. 

Her talents contributed to: KWKW, KLVE, KMEX, NBC, CBS, Disney, El Pueblo de Los Angeles, Olvera Street, Hispanic Women's Council, Junior League of Pasadena and Los Angeles, San Marino Unified School District, The Archdiocese of Los Angeles and many more ...

Born in Mexico City in the late 30s, my mother was exposed to the enduring history and culture of her native land.

Her family's appreciation for art, music, literature ,theater and Mexican cinema influenced her creative expression and endeavours throughout her life.

By the late 40s, the family emigrated to the United States and soon began her admiration for everything American.

Born on the 4th of July, what better place to celebrate her successes through her lifetime but in the U.S.A.

A fine Yankee Doodle herself.

My mother became an  accomplished song writer and lyricist. Illustrator and painter. As well as producing her own album. She was a wife, mother and grandmother. Friend and confidant to many. It was easy to fall in love with her, as she herself was the incarnation of love.

 A walking romance novel filled with passion, drama, heartbreak and triumphs. Author of a yet to be published book. She was my mother, my friend, my protector and my guide in life, as is now in the beyond. She is profoundly missed but  her legacy lives on through her poetic words and music. It will console and remind us to never, ever, ever give up because it is through that faith everything is possible and miracles do exist.
